Register Guidelines E-Books Today's Posts Search

Go Back   MobileRead Forums > E-Book Readers > PocketBook

Notices

Reply
 
Thread Tools Search this Thread
Old 06-11-2011, 03:30 PM   #1
qariwa55
Enthusiast
qariwa55 began at the beginning.
 
Posts: 35
Karma: 18
Join Date: Apr 2011
Device: Boyue T62D
Changing fonts in fbreader

I am a relatively new owner of the Pocketbook Pro 602. One reason I bought it was to be able to read Arabic books on it. It came with FW 2.0.4 and Arabic letters were not joined. Following the company's advice, I upgraded to the 2.0.5 Arabic FW version and then 2.0.6. Arabic is now joining, but I cannot switch fonts AT ALL in fbreader (but is not problem on coolreader or the interface font). I went back to FW 2.0.5 (NOT the Arabic), and then back up to 2.0.6. All three FWs look the same: I cannot change fonts in fbreader for any of them. I CAN change font sizes. I have tried books in both Arabic and English, but cannot change fonts for any of them.

I tried loading fbreader180. That can switch fonts, but it does not have joining in Arabic (which makes it virtually impossible to read Arabic).

The font that fbreader is stuck on looks horrid in Arabic, though not terrible in English (I cannot tell what it is for sure, but something ling Liberation Sans).

I talked with the American branch of the company, but they do not seem to have a clue.

Any ideas?
qariwa55 is offline   Reply With Quote
Old 06-11-2011, 05:09 PM   #2
paola
Wizard
pa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.
 
paola's Avatar
 
Posts: 2,824
Karma: 5843878
Join Date: Oct 2010
Location: UK
Device: Pocketbook Pro 903, (beloved Pocketbook 360 RIP), Kobo Mini, Kobo Aura
Hi qariwa, what fonts would you like to be able to switch between? I have firmware 2.1.0, and I could try and see whether arabic works for me (though it won't be before monday, as i am travelling without my PB903). You could also try to see whether the jacked adobe version works - it should read CSS files (assuming that is the problem). One other thought:what format are you using? on my360 I noticed that FBreader180 displays the wrong font for mobi (at least on one book).
paola is offline   Reply With Quote
Old 06-11-2011, 05:38 PM   #3
qariwa55
Enthusiast
qariwa55 began at the beginning.
 
Posts: 35
Karma: 18
Join Date: Apr 2011
Device: Boyue T62D
Quote:
Originally Posted by paola View Post
Hi qariwa, what fonts would you like to be able to switch between? I have firmware 2.1.0, and I could try and see whether arabic works for me (though it won't be before monday, as i am travelling without my PB903). You could also try to see whether the jacked adobe version works - it should read CSS files (assuming that is the problem). One other thought:what format are you using? on my360 I noticed that FBreader180 displays the wrong font for mobi (at least on one book).
I have tried using fbreader on epub files, both Arabic and English. I like using CharisSIL which I downloaded. It is close to DejaVu Serif. For Arabic, I would like to use Droid Sans MTI Arabic (for Arabic), both Regular and Bold, which came with the firmware. I also downloaded Scheherazade from SIL, which looks good when I put it as the interface font.

I haven't ever looked at a mobi document.

As a relative newbie to ebooks, I don't know about the jacked adobe version. Certainly the regular adobe digital editions viewer cannot handle Arabic (would it really be so hard for Adobe to fix that???).

The Arabic ebook I have experimented with doesn't even have CSS files. I played around with the font declarations (at the beginning of the body of text) in the Arabic ebook, but this had zero effect one way or the other. I can't change fonts in the free English-language ebooks I downloaded at books.google.com with fbreader anyway, so I don't even think the problem has to do with Arabic.


I do think it is a pocketbook screwup with their firmware.

Thanks for trying this out on 2.1.0
qariwa55 is offline   Reply With Quote
Old 06-13-2011, 05:24 PM   #4
paola
Wizard
pa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.
 
paola's Avatar
 
Posts: 2,824
Karma: 5843878
Join Date: Oct 2010
Location: UK
Device: Pocketbook Pro 903, (beloved Pocketbook 360 RIP), Kobo Mini, Kobo Aura
Hi, I have checked, and unfortunately no, I cannot change fonts either. Plus, I have tried the hacked adobereader version, but on my PB903 it does not work. I guess for the moment the only fix is to embed your preferred fonts in the document
paola is offline   Reply With Quote
Old 06-13-2011, 05:46 PM   #5
qariwa55
Enthusiast
qariwa55 began at the beginning.
 
Posts: 35
Karma: 18
Join Date: Apr 2011
Device: Boyue T62D
Quote:
Originally Posted by paola View Post
Hi, I have checked, and unfortunately no, I cannot change fonts either. Plus, I have tried the hacked adobereader version, but on my PB903 it does not work. I guess for the moment the only fix is to embed your preferred fonts in the document
paola, thanks for checking. I tried embedding fonts, and even that did not work, though perhaps I am not doing that right.

I would say that not being able to change fonts in fbreader is a pretty major bug. How can we let the developers know? Or rather, get them to fix it?
qariwa55 is offline   Reply With Quote
Old 06-13-2011, 06:03 PM   #6
paola
Wizard
pa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.
 
paola's Avatar
 
Posts: 2,824
Karma: 5843878
Join Date: Oct 2010
Location: UK
Device: Pocketbook Pro 903, (beloved Pocketbook 360 RIP), Kobo Mini, Kobo Aura
Quote:
Originally Posted by qariwa55 View Post
paola, thanks for checking. I tried embedding fonts, and even that did not work, though perhaps I am not doing that right.

I would say that not being able to change fonts in fbreader is a pretty major bug. How can we let the developers know? Or rather, get them to fix it?
in the meantime, the good news is that FBreader180 would allow you to do that - though of course you wont' have the notes!

The guys on the russian forum are pretty vocal, so either they would let the programmers know, or they've found a workaround, or we here are doing something wrong. The problem for me is that there is a lot I think I am missing from googletranslate.

Here we can let mtravellerh know and ask him to feed this back to the GiK, though I haven't seen mtravellerh around too much lately. I guess if worse comes to worst I'll try and googletranslate a question on the Russian forum! Since they say they fixed bugs in fbreader, I wonder whether I/we are doing something wrong, though, as it seems to me those guyst are not complaining about being unable to change fonts.

Tomorrow I'll experiment with embedded fonts, and let you know.
paola is offline   Reply With Quote
Old 06-13-2011, 07:40 PM   #7
troll05
Harmless idiot
tro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.
 
troll05's Avatar
 
Posts: 3,411
Karma: 2154829
Join Date: Nov 2010
Location: Zuhause
Device: PB622, Nexus7, Sony PRS 350, Tolino und nur noch wenig toter Baum:(
Quote:
Originally Posted by paola View Post
in the meantime, the good news is that FBreader180 would allow you to do that - though of course you wont' have the notes!
unfortunately FBReader180 is still not working properly with any FW newer than 2.0.4
I already contacted GrayNM about this, but the last thing I heard, he was unable to fix it because missing SDK. Since it's released by now, maybe he'll get it up and running soon

Edit: Hi paola, just read your post in the "903 attention..." thread, now it works, although the wrist turning function is still unavailable

Last edited by troll05; 06-13-2011 at 07:55 PM.
troll05 is offline   Reply With Quote
Old 06-14-2011, 12:47 AM   #8
qariwa55
Enthusiast
qariwa55 began at the beginning.
 
Posts: 35
Karma: 18
Join Date: Apr 2011
Device: Boyue T62D
Quote:
Originally Posted by troll05 View Post
unfortunately FBReader180 is still not working properly with any FW newer than 2.0.4
I already contacted GrayNM about this, but the last thing I heard, he was unable to fix it because missing SDK. Since it's released by now, maybe he'll get it up and running soon
That is a little strange. My FBReader180 works okay with my FW 2.0.6 (on 602), it seems, including the changing of fonts. However, there is no joining with the Arabic letters, which means there is no Arabic support.
qariwa55 is offline   Reply With Quote
Old 06-14-2011, 04:07 AM   #9
troll05
Harmless idiot
tro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.
 
troll05's Avatar
 
Posts: 3,411
Karma: 2154829
Join Date: Nov 2010
Location: Zuhause
Device: PB622, Nexus7, Sony PRS 350, Tolino und nur noch wenig toter Baum:(
Mine is working now too, thanks to paola
troll05 is offline   Reply With Quote
Old 06-14-2011, 04:46 AM   #10
paola
Wizard
pa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.
 
paola's Avatar
 
Posts: 2,824
Karma: 5843878
Join Date: Oct 2010
Location: UK
Device: Pocketbook Pro 903, (beloved Pocketbook 360 RIP), Kobo Mini, Kobo Aura
Quote:
Originally Posted by qariwa55 View Post
That is a little strange. My FBReader180 works okay with my FW 2.0.6 (on 602), it seems, including the changing of fonts. However, there is no joining with the Arabic letters, which means there is no Arabic support.
does it work also if you show the total page count?

@Troll05: pageturning is working on mine, too, though a little bit erratically (i guess because it is a little bit unwieldy): I had to put the rotation angle to 20 degrees, though.
paola is offline   Reply With Quote
Old 06-14-2011, 05:11 PM   #11
paola
Wizard
pa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.
 
paola's Avatar
 
Posts: 2,824
Karma: 5843878
Join Date: Oct 2010
Location: UK
Device: Pocketbook Pro 903, (beloved Pocketbook 360 RIP), Kobo Mini, Kobo Aura
qariwa, we must be doing something wrong - I have tried with other books, and fbreader works perfectly well at changing fonts. I cannot see what the problem is, as I can read the same book on the PB360 in the font I like, so I would have thought there shouldn'd be a major problem with the book itself, but obviously there is. And it was indeed strange that nobody was complaining about that.

EDIT: problem solved (at least in my case). My EPUB are all translated, and in the CSS style file for the declaration of the text I had:
Code:
.calibre {
    display: block;
    font-family: "LexiaDaMa", serif;
    font-size: 1em;
    line-height: 1.2;
    margin-bottom: 0;
    margin-left: 5pt;
    margin-right: 5pt;
    margin-top: 0;
    padding-left: 0;
    padding-right: 0;
    text-align: justify
    }
The font family declaration (highlighted in bold) for some reason seem to be creating the problems in the PB903 - I removed it, and all is well. Hope it works for you too!

Last edited by paola; 06-14-2011 at 05:26 PM.
paola is offline   Reply With Quote
Old 06-15-2011, 09:14 AM   #12
qariwa55
Enthusiast
qariwa55 began at the beginning.
 
Posts: 35
Karma: 18
Join Date: Apr 2011
Device: Boyue T62D
Paola, I am traveling now (in a motel room). I'll try that when I get to my destination, probably tomorrow.
qariwa55 is offline   Reply With Quote
Old 06-16-2011, 01:41 PM   #13
jane10021
Member
jane10021 began at the beginning.
 
Posts: 17
Karma: 10
Join Date: Jan 2011
Device: hanlin V3, pocketbook 360
Paola, where do I find this CSS style file?
I have more or less the same problem: I get the same font, whatever font I choose. Maybe your solution is the problem in my files. But I wouldn't know where to look for this file.

thanks!
jane

Quote:
Originally Posted by
EDIT: problem solved (at least in my case). My EPUB are all translated, and in the CSS style file for the declaration of the text I had:
[CODE
.calibre {
display: block;
font-family: "LexiaDaMa", serif;
font-size: 1em;
line-height: 1.2;
margin-bottom: 0;
margin-left: 5pt;
margin-right: 5pt;
margin-top: 0;
padding-left: 0;
padding-right: 0;
text-align: justify
}
[/CODE]
The font family declaration (highlighted in bold) for some reason seem to be creating the problems in the PB903 - I removed it, and all is well. Hope it works for you too!
jane10021 is offline   Reply With Quote
Old 06-16-2011, 05:53 PM   #14
paola
Wizard
pa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.paola ought to be getting tired of karma fortunes by now.
 
paola's Avatar
 
Posts: 2,824
Karma: 5843878
Join Date: Oct 2010
Location: UK
Device: Pocketbook Pro 903, (beloved Pocketbook 360 RIP), Kobo Mini, Kobo Aura
Hi Jane,
an EPUB is a compressed file; among its elements there is a style file with extension .css. The easiest way to modify it is to use Calibre.
Once in Calibre, right-click on the book you are interested in and select "Tweak epub". Now a window pops up with a tab "Explode epub". If you click on it, your computer file manager will show all the files in the epub.
Scroll the list until you find a file with .css extension, right-click on it and open it with your preferred text editor - in that file you remove the "font declaration" I highlighted in my previous message.
Close the editor, close the file manager window and go back to Calibre - now you can also click the tab "rebuild epub". Do that, and that's it, you just have to transfer the book back on your device.
Hope it helps!
paola is offline   Reply With Quote
Old 06-16-2011, 06:17 PM   #15
troll05
Harmless idiot
tro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.troll05 ought to be getting tired of karma fortunes by now.
 
troll05's Avatar
 
Posts: 3,411
Karma: 2154829
Join Date: Nov 2010
Location: Zuhause
Device: PB622, Nexus7, Sony PRS 350, Tolino und nur noch wenig toter Baum:(
Quote:
Originally Posted by paola View Post
Hi Jane,
an EPUB is a compressed file; among its elements there is a style file with extension .css. The easiest way to modify it is to use Calibre.
Once in Calibre, right-click on the book you are interested in and select "Tweak epub". Now a window pops up with a tab "Explode epub". If you click on it, your computer file manager will show all the files in the epub.
Scroll the list until you find a file with .css extension, right-click on it and open it with your preferred text editor - in that file you remove the "font declaration" I highlighted in my previous message.
Close the editor, close the file manager window and go back to Calibre - now you can also click the tab "rebuild epub". Do that, and that's it, you just have to transfer the book back on your device.
Hope it helps!
Sure this works, but it would be far more convenient to have the reading apks like fbreader or cr3 do this for us
I set my hopes to the developers to tweak their programs, so we don't bhave to tweak our Epubs to get the desired result

@GrayNM and pkbo: Great work so far!!!
troll05 is offline   Reply With Quote
Reply

Tags
fonts fbreader arabic


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Selecting and changing fonts Circleof05ths Calibre 0 05-15-2010 06:26 PM
Changing fonts Soxendom OpenInkpot 2 01-03-2010 10:14 AM
Changing fonts not working? tselling Astak EZReader 11 09-21-2009 03:03 PM
changing margins and fonts? BruceB Calibre 3 02-09-2009 05:20 PM
FBReader fonts rsperberg Reading and Management 8 09-25-2005 08:31 PM


All times are GMT -4. The time now is 08:09 PM.


MobileRead.com is a privately owned, operated and funded community.